Humana People to People is a global humanitarian movement operating in 46 countries with 30 organizations, reaching over 17.9 million people worldwide. Our work focuses on education, health, sustainable agriculture, and community development The program 10 months. 3 stages. 1. Training (3 months – Denmark, Lindersvold) • Development studies • Culture, politics, health & agriculture 2. Field Volunteering (6 months – Africa or Asia) Destinations: Malawi, Zambia, Mozambique, India • Work directly with local communities • Projects in education, health, agriculture, or development 3.
